Output 024c63aabca11df8c8e16f3f196d415f9ed034ac75ac7607dbd39e1a7bed0d17:1

value
4383719544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9be926bc4243fd4ef1e6f03eba5b742c31082b8 OP_EQUAL
address
3MYLrLpwEis3NiwW65QQorMgxg6brJbxqf
transaction
024c63aabca11df8c8e16f3f196d415f9ed034ac75ac7607dbd39e1a7bed0d17
spent
true